How much do production associ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for production associate in Ishpeming, MI is $17.06,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.62 and $18.51 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

The main difference between a Production Associate and a Manufacturing Technician lies in their responsibilities and skill requirements. Production Associates typically perform basic assembly and packaging tasks with minimal technical training, while Manufacturing Technicians handle equipment maintenance, troubleshooting, and more technical duties. Both roles are essential in manufacturing environments, but Manufacturing Technicians usually require additional technical certifications or vocational training.

What are some typical challenges production associates face when adjusting to fast-paced manufacturing environments?

Production Associates often encounter challenges such as adapting to rapidly changing production schedules, maintaining high attention to detail while working efficiently, and learning to operate various machinery safely. Additionally, they must quickly become familiar with strict quality standards and safety protocols. Collaborating effectively with team members and supervisors is essential to ensure smooth workflow and meet production targets.

What is an entry level production associate?

An entry-level production associate is a worker who performs basic tasks on a manufacturing or production line, often requiring minimal prior experience. They typically follow instructions, operate machinery or tools, and work under supervision, with opportunities to learn skills such as quality control, safety procedures, and equipment operation.

What is a production associate?

Production Associates are entry-level workers who assist in the manufacturing process within factories or production facilities. Their responsibilities typically include assembling products, operating machinery, monitoring production lines, and ensuring quality standards are met. They may also be responsible for packaging, labeling, and basic maintenance of equipment. Production Associates play a crucial role in maintaining efficient workflow and supporting higher-level technicians or supervisors. The role often requires attention to detail, manual dexterity, and the ability to follow safety protocols.

What does a production associate do?

A production associate’s job duties depend on the industry in which they work. If you’re a manufacturing production associate, then your responsibilities include maintaining production equipment and assemblies, ensuring quality control, overseeing manufacturing personnel, ordering materials, monitoring packaging and shipping of the product, and handling clerical tasks like work orders and documentation. As a production associate in the film and TV industry, your duties include hiring and scheduling actors and technical staff, resolving technical challenges such as equipment failure, and maintaining relationships with suppliers and vendors.
